About this role

The Manager, Financial Reporting will have oversight of financial reporting, audit support and general ledger management for Non-US ("cross-border) based business and support services including US India (USI), ARDC (Mexico), and Costa Rica (CR). The manager will support the integration of acquisitions or expansion of existing organizations. Engage with multiple stakeholders to ensure accurate and timely reporting, with a strong understanding of statutory financial statement requirements.Recruiting for this role ends on April 27th 2026.Work you'll do+ Responsible for the oversight and review of all cross-border reporting requirements including financial statements of USI, Mexico, CR, Puerto Rico, and certain foreign holding companies.+ Review and approval of funding of all cross-border operations.+ Coordination with US teams on status of India tax and defined benefits positions and related accounting (e.g., uncertain tax positions) and planning/forecasting for these areas+ Accounting and financial reporting for US consulting projects in India or Mexico that qualify for permanent establishment treatment (includes funding requests and approval of financial statements)+ Perform analysis and review of the following: account reconciliations, dashboards, significant journal entries, periodic and year-end closing activities, lead schedules (USI and projects entities), headcount statistics, blocked headcount accounting and royalty accounting.+ Global Finance Services/CoRe Procurement

- oversight/consultation on accounting methods, including organizational structure and blocked headcount.+ Delivery Centers

- operations oversight including consolidation accounting.+ Periodic foreign exchange gain/loss tracking and related balance sheet revaluation.+ Assists with other operational aspects of Financial Reporting team including financial statement referencing, documentation and internal control support, and testing of system enhancements.+ Perform other tasks as assigned.The TeamThe Financial Reporting group has a view of the overall Firm and works closely with US Firms' Controllership and others within Finance and Administration. The group is a hub for the Firm's compliance reporting and works with several other groups to ensure the books and records of the firm are recorded and reported on efficiently and accurately.QualificationsRequired:+ Bachelor's degree in accounting or related degree+ CPA+ Minimum of 8 years of experience, or 5 years of accounting/auditing professional services firm experience+ A strong grasp of intermediate accounting principles.+ Experience with financial analysis and consolidations.+ Strong technical aptitude relating to accounting systems.+ Limited immigration sponsorship may be available+ Ability to travel 0-10%, on average, based on the work you do and the clients and industries/sectors you serve.Preferred:+ SAP and Workiva experience+ Strong interpersonal communication skills are crucial as the position involves the ability to satisfy and influence various stakeholders, including senior management.+ Must be a team player, detail oriented with be able to manage multiple priorities and work in a fast-paced dynamic environment.The wage range for this role takes into account the wide range of factors that are considered in making compensation decisions including but not limited to skill sets; experience and training; licensure and certifications; and other business and organizational needs.
